fortunes-spam/mastodon-bot/Dockerfile

16 lines
413 B
Docker

FROM alpine
LABEL \
maintainer="Davide Alberani <da@mimante.net>"
RUN \
apk add --no-cache git fortune python3 py3-pip py3-cffi py3-six py3-requests py3-cryptography && \
pip3 install --break-system-packages Mastodon.py && \
cd / && \
git clone https://github.com/alberanid/fortunes-spam.git
COPY fortunes-spam-bot.py /fortunes-spam
WORKDIR /fortunes-spam
ENTRYPOINT ["python3", "fortunes-spam-bot.py"]